Ghanaian Producer Emelia Kumi wins ‘Best Producer’ in Nigeria

25th November 2019

Industrious, Ghanaian producer, Emelia Kumi, has won the Best Producer at the just ended 2019 ZAFAA Film Awards held in Nigeria on Sunday 24th November 2019 at Transcorp Hilton hotel at Abuja.

The young producer who entered the film industry as a PA (Production Assistant) on productions by Venus Films, finally paid her dues by graduating into a producer.

Filled with gratitude, Emelia dedicated her awards to the CEO of Venus Films, Alhaji Abdul Salam Mumuni, for believing in her and giving her the opportunity.

The elated awardee, disclosed that having cut her teeth from PA to a producer, she’s preparing to executively producer her first feature movie with a working title ‘Africa.’

Ending her thanks giving speech, Emelia urged filmakers and event organisers to invest in crew and production; the same way they invest massively in actors and artistes.

Other Ghanaian personalities who also won awards include Emelia Brobbey , Van Vicker , Jackie Appiah , John Dumelo , Frank Gharbin,Evander Kwame Agyemang
